A backflow preventer is an assembly, device, or method that prevents the reversal of the flow of liquids into a potable water supply system. Local utilities departments require testing of the backflow assemblies to ensure they are working properly. Depending on the County/City you live in, you will be required to have the backflow tested annually, biennially, or decennially. If you are unsure which category you fall under, please contact your utilities department.
